The Gondwana Care Trust supports Environmental Health in Namibia by promoting sustainable practices that protect ecosystems while benefiting local communities. Through conservation initiatives, responsible resource management, and environmental education, the Trust helps safeguard Namibia’s natural landscapes for future generations. Projects include habitat protection, waste reduction efforts, and community awareness programmes that encourage environmentally responsible behaviour. By integrating conservation with community wellbeing, the Gondwana Care Trust strengthens the connection between people and nature, ensuring that environmental health contributes to long-term sustainability, resilience and opportunity across Namibia.
